The YPG and YPJ, supported by international airstrikes and supplies from the US-led coalition, launched a successful campaign to retake Kobanê in January 2015. The city's liberation was a major symbolic victory for the Kurdish forces, demonstrating their military capabilities and boosting their morale.

The Kurdish People's Protection Units (YPG) was formed in 2013 as a military wing of the Democratic Union Party (PYD), a Kurdish nationalist organization. The YPG's primary goal was to protect Kurdish civilians from the violence and chaos of the Syrian Civil War. Initially, the group focused on defending Kurdish-majority areas in northern Syria, but as the conflict escalated, they began to expand their operations.
